The Dooly County Bobcats will head out on the road to  challenge  the Portal Panthers  at 6:00  p.m.  on Tuesday. Dooly County is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 3.6  goals per game  this season.
Dooly County is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up  on Tuesday. Their defense stepped up to hand Southwest Georgia STEM Charter  a   1-0 shutout. Dooly County's winning goal came courtesy of  Eunise Reyes.
 Meanwhile, Portal waltzed into their matchup  on Tuesday with two straight wins... but they left with three. They came within a single  goal of losing the streak, but they secured  a   3-2 W against the Trojans. The final result isn't all the surprising considering Portal's considerable advantage  in MaxPreps' Georgia soccer rankings (they are ranked 145th, while Brooks County are ranked 353rd).
 Dooly County is  on a roll lately: they've  won eight of their last nine games. That's provided a nice bump to their 14-7 record  this season. The  vict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as  they  scored 34  goals over those nine  contests. As for Portal, their win was  their third straight at home, which  pushed their record up to 13-3.
